I feel we will see some considerable improvement from Granada this season, owned along with Udinese and Watford by the Pozzo family, they have managed to stabilize in the top flight after two seasons and can start to kick on. Their summer signings of defensive midfielder Manuel Iturra from Malaga with the Champions League experience he brings, Algerian international midfielder Yacine Brahimi, plus veteran strikers Riki and Piti (with 31 top flight goals between them last season) looks really good business. Unfortunately Riki cannot play today.

On the road, Genoa are 2-2-6, but have only conceded 13 goals, just one less than 3rd placed Lazio, they are well organised, disciplined and keep their shape well, they have performed well against the top clubs conceding just two goals and collecting five points from visits to Lazio, Udinese, Milan and Inter.

No Andrea Pirlo or Giorgio Chielleni for Juventus, who even given their resources, face a daunting 17 days with Serie A matches against Chievo and Fiorentina, a Champions League trip to Glasgow and Coppa Italia semi final against Lazio.
